this is a fake blog post

Exploring the latest trends, best practices, and innovative approaches in contemporary web development

December 202415 min readWeb Development

Table of Contents

What you'll learn:
  • Modern JavaScript frameworks and their evolution
  • State management patterns in React applications
  • Performance optimization techniques
  • Building accessible and inclusive web experiences

The landscape of web development has evolved dramatically over the past decade. From simple HTML pages to complex, interactive applications, we've witnessed a transformation that has fundamentally changed how we approach building for the web.

Modern frameworks like React, Vue, and Angular have introduced component-based architectures that promote reusability and maintainability. These tools have become essential in creating scalable applications that can handle complex user interactions while maintaining performance.

In this comprehensive guide, we'll explore the key concepts that define modern web development, from component architecture to state management, and discuss best practices that will help you build better applications.

Bookmarks & Saved Content

📚 Essential Reading List

A curated collection of must-read articles and resources for web developers. These bookmarks represent the most valuable insights from industry leaders and innovative thinkers in the development community.

React 18 Concurrent Features Deep Dive
Advanced TypeScript Patterns for Large Applications
Web Performance Optimization Techniques

🔧 Tools & Resources

Development tools, libraries, and resources that enhance productivity and code quality. From debugging utilities to performance monitoring solutions, these bookmarks contain everything needed for modern development.

Chrome DevTools Advanced Debugging
VS Code Extensions for React Development
Bundle Analyzer and Performance Monitoring

The landscape of web development has evolved dramatically over the past decade. From simple HTML pages to complex, interactive applications, we've witnessed a transformation that has fundamentally changed how we approach building for the web.

Modern frameworks like React, Vue, and Angular have introduced component-based architectures that promote reusability and maintainability. These tools have become essential in creating scalable applications that can handle complex user interactions while maintaining performance.

In this comprehensive guide, we'll explore the key concepts that define modern web development, from component architecture to state management, and discuss best practices that will help you build better applications.

Development Environment Settings

// Package.json configuration
{
  "name": "modern-web-app",
  "version": "1.0.0",
  "scripts": {
    "dev": "next dev",
    "build": "next build",
    "start": "next start",
    "lint": "eslint . --ext .ts,.tsx"
  },
  "dependencies": {
    "react": "^18.2.0",
    "next": "^14.0.0",
    "typescript": "^5.0.0",
    "framer-motion": "^10.16.0"
  }
}

Proper configuration is the foundation of any successful development project. From package management to build optimization, having the right settings can significantly impact both development experience and application performance.

Modern development environments require careful consideration of tooling choices, dependency management, and build processes. The configuration above represents a solid starting point for React applications with TypeScript and modern build tools.

The landscape of web development has evolved dramatically over the past decade. From simple HTML pages to complex, interactive applications, we've witnessed a transformation that has fundamentally changed how we approach building for the web.

Modern frameworks like React, Vue, and Angular have introduced component-based architectures that promote reusability and maintainability. These tools have become essential in creating scalable applications that can handle complex user interactions while maintaining performance.

In this comprehensive guide, we'll explore the key concepts that define modern web development, from component architecture to state management, and discuss best practices that will help you build better applications.

Share Your Knowledge

🚀

Ready to Share This Article?

Found this content valuable? Share it with your network to help other developers discover these insights and best practices for modern web development.

📋 Copy Link
🐦 Share on Twitter
📧 Email Article

Knowledge sharing is fundamental to the growth of the development community. When we share our experiences, challenges, and solutions, we contribute to a collective understanding that benefits everyone.

Whether through blog posts, open source contributions, or mentoring, sharing knowledge creates ripple effects that extend far beyond our immediate circle. The insights we share today become the foundation for tomorrow's innovations and breakthroughs.

As we continue to push the boundaries of what's possible on the web, remember that the best solutions often emerge from collaboration and shared learning. The development community thrives when we lift each other up through knowledge sharing and mutual support.